> For the complete documentation index, see [llms.txt](https://docs.gm.ai/llms.txt). Markdown versions of documentation pages are available by appending `.md` to page URLs; this page is available as [Markdown](https://docs.gm.ai/gmai-ecosystem/gminfra/gmmodel/features.md).

# Features

### **gm-01-8B Model**

* Pretrained and Instruction-Tuned: The model is finely tuned for a variety of generative text tasks.
* Blockchain Function Calling: Supports various blockchain-related operations.

### API Support

* cURL: Facilitates easy API requests from the command line.
* Python and JavaScript: Comprehensive documentation for integration with popular programming languages.

### Built-In Functions

* Market Data Access: Allows users to check the price of BTC and various altcoins.
* Market Sentiment Analysis: Provides insights into market sentiment based on real-time data.
* Check social sentiment: hecks social media platforms to gauge the sentiment around specific cryptocurrencies. This real-time data can provide valuable insights into public opinion and potential market movements.
* Check hottest daily news: The Hottest Daily News feature provides the latest news articles and updates related to various cryptocurrencies.


---

# Agent Instructions
This documentation is published with GitBook. GitBook is the documentation platform designed so that both humans and AI agents can read, navigate, and reason over technical content effectively. Learn more at gitbook.com.

## Querying This Documentation
If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ter, and the optional `goal` query parameter:

```
GET https://docs.gm.ai/gmai-ecosystem/gminfra/gmmodel/features.md?ask=<question>&goal=<endgoal>
```

`ask` is the immediate question: it should be specific, self-contained, and written in natural language.
`goal` is optional and describes the broader end goal you are ultimately trying to accomplish on behalf of the user. GitBook uses it to tailor the answer towards what is most useful for that goal.

The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
